      @@savagebob911 Not that your commentary regarding alcohol is wrong but vapor lock has been a problem ever since the mechanical fuel pump was installed to draw fuel past any hot area on the way to the engine. Odd as it might seem, prior to fuel pumps, gasoline was gravity fed to the engine before fuel pumps were invented. The Model T Ford had its tank mounted above the cowling, below the windshield, thereby above the engine.
      When pumps were added to the system, mechanics were wrapping fuel lines with all sort of shields to keep the heat out. Some worked better than others but if it was hot enough, the fuel vaporized and everyone got to take a break until it cooled and re-condensed.
      The best solution to date (aside from electric cars and they have their own issues...) is an electric fuel pump placed near (but NOT in the fuel tank). Fuel is pumped to the engine under pressure and there are no vapor locks. Whether the intake uses carbs or fuel injection, they all like to get their feed under pressure.

      If they could disable traction control on the volvo however which you absolutely can do on these models volvo. my experience with modern Volvos and off-road mode option with DSTC disabled or reduced is it surprisingly capable… like it will fight its way through. And the transmutation is a normal slush box auto so it can spin and slip way more than a CVT without getting damaged so less chance of it stopping you and over riding. It’s also less “blind” vs X-Mode it knows where the slip is occurring and focuses on trying to over come it. Turns it’s open digs into LSD diffs using its brakes and matching side to side speed and shuffling power around. the key is however turning off traction control so doesn’t cut power, if leave TC (DSTC) enabled its forced to give up after a few seconds when it kicks in to try to stop the wheels from freely spinning. That’s why the volvo was feeling itself but keep stopping was stupid TC getting in the way.

      Yeah, that sand is really soft and really deep but the Crosstreks are very light and have as good of a chance as any other AWD out there. The problem is usually that the driver does not know what settings to use, like for instance you want to turn traction control off and VDC. Unless you have the deep sand or mud later evolution of Xmode you are better off NOT using it because it will just turn off anyway and will kill your momentum. But the main issue is that people of any car brand do not have the right type of tires (wheels) and/or do not know that just having the right tire is not enough, you must also air it down so that it can deform and float the sand. The crosstrek actually has a lot of advantage over its bigger brothers because the brake system is smaller, allowing for smaller wheels and taller bigger sidewall tires that REALLY HELP alot when aired down compared to wheels that are too large on tires that don't have enough sidewall to float sand well.
